POSITION SUMMARY

The Executive Partner works directly with the CEO to drive execution discipline, prepare the organization for Board and executive decision-making, and ensure priorities translate into results. This role combines selective executive support with governance, cross-functional leadership, and operational cadence. The Executive Partner is a true executive partner—not a traditional Executive Assistant—responsible for ensuring clarity, readiness, and accountability at the highest levels of the organization.

This candidate must be able to meet with the CEO in PA or report to the Anaheim, California office. In addition, the work schedule must align with CEO who is based on the East coast but regularly travels to the West Coast.

DUTIES
  • Proactively anticipates the CEO’s needs in advance of Board, Executive Leadership Team, and critical external meetings
  • Surface missing inputs, strategic risks, and organizational sensitivities early to support well-informed, timely decision-making
  • Prepare concise, insight-driven briefing materials that clearly frame issues, outline options, and enable rapid executive clarity
  • Own end-to-end preparation for ELT sessions, CEO-led forums, ensuring materials are complete, consistent, and decision-ready
  • Serve as the final quality gate for all CEO- and Board level deliverables, ensuring clarity, accuracy, alignment, and narrative cohesion.
  • Maintain and continuously improve the company’s operating rhythm, ensuring disciplined preparation and follow-through.
  • Maintain a single source of truth for decisions, commitments, action items and strategic priorities.
  • Track, drive, and close follow-up items with rigor-supporting accountability across the leadership team
  • Ensure cross-functional alignment and resolve issues that span teams, functions, or ambiguous ownership
  • Lead CEO-sponsored initiatives and special projects from concept through execution, often in ambiguous or rapidly evolving environments.
  • Drive complex, cross-functional challenges to resolution, clarifying scope, stakeholders, and success metrics.
  • Manage complex scheduling, sequencing and logistics that maximize the CEO’s time against strategic priorities
  • Prioritize incoming requests and decisions to protect focus and ensure alignment with enterprise objectives.
QUALIFICATIONS
  • Bachelor’s degree required; MBA or advanced degree preferred.
  • 8–15+ years of experience in executive support, strategy, operations, finance, or consulting
  • Exceptional attention to detail paired with strong business judgment
  • Comfortable operating in ambiguity and holding leaders accountable
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ly:
    PowerPoint (must be able to build, edit, and format executive presentations)
